Concept Introduction:

Alkynes can be prepared by alkylation of acetylene.

Acetylene forms its conjugate base in presence of a strong base like sodium amide.

Reaction of this acetylide anion with alkyl halides produces higher alkynes.

If the alkyl halides are secondary or tertiary, instead of substitution, elimination reaction takes place.

Double dehydrohalogenation of either vicinal or geminaldihalides also produces alkynes.

This reaction occurs in the presence of excess sodium amide.
